Printing
Printing a Document
 
When you print from a Macintosh, you need to check the printer software setting in each application you use. Follow these steps to print from a Macintosh.
1. Open a Macintosh application and select the file you want to print.
2. Open the File menu and click Page Setup (Document Setup in some applications).
3. Choose your paper size, orientation, scaling, and other options and click OK.
4. Open the File menu and click Print.
5. Choose the number of copies you want and indicate which pages you want to print.
6. Click Print when you finish setting the options.
